  "summary": "The Director General of the Commission to Investigate Allegations of Bribery and Corruption (CIABOC), Ranga Dissanayake, has expressed concerns over the feasibility of certain promises in the National People’s Power (NPP) manifesto, A Thriving Nation – A Beautiful Life. Speaking during a discussion following the release of the third biannual report on manifesto monitoring, Dissanayake questioned the feasibility of establishing Anti-Corruption Investigation Offices in each district, suggesting such a move would require agreement from CIABOC and amendments to the Anti-Corruption Act. Additionally, he raised questions about the transfer of powers from the Executive President should the pledge to abolish this position be fulfilled, noting that successive governments have made similar commitments since 1994. Executive Director of the Institute for Democratic Reforms and Electoral Studies (IRES), Manjula Gajanayake, clarified that Dissanayake's remarks were his personal views and not a representation of government policy.",
